If you are an engineer and are worried about the instability of the Brazilian job market, know that engineering is booming in the United States.

The Infrastructure Investment and Jobs Act, which was signed into law by President Joe Biden in 2021, authorizes the US government to invest $1.2 trillion in the areas of transportation and infrastructure in general. This means a substantial increase in energy, transportation, internet access, water infrastructure and more.

Part of this program is the Buy America, Build America Act (BABA), which encourages that all goods, products, materials and services involved in these infrastructure works be produced on American soil. Not only should iron and other American ores be prioritized, but also all other construction materials manufactured on American soil.

In addition, the US Department of Transportation has also authorized federal investment for road, bridge and highway construction. And it also released $91 billion to repair and modernize all public transportation in the United States.

This U.S. government program has fostered a great deal of American engineering and many opportunities for all engineers who are qualified to participate in construction, power and infrastructure work.

Many people think that marrying an American, having a close relative living in the United States or investing in the United States are the only ways to get a Green Card, but this is not true!

The EB-2 NIW (National Interest Waiver) visa was created by the U.S. government in 1990 to encourage the migration of skilled workers to the United States. International workers who can prove that they are skilled in strategic areas and can contribute to U.S. progress are valuable to the United States.

EB-2 NIW Visa

If you are an engineering graduate, have more than five years of experience and exceptional or extraordinary professional skills in your field, you may be eligible for a Green Card!

Engineering is a field of national interest for the United States, and its expertise is highly valued in America.

And, if you are approved for a Green Card under this visa category, your spouse and children under the age of 21 will also be granted their respective Green Cards.

All this without you needing a previous job offer in the United States - as the main requirement to be eligible for this type of visa is your qualification, and skilled workers are beneficial to the US economy and progress.
